From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:

  Postilion \Pos*til"ion\, n. [F. postillon, It. postiglione, fr.
     posta post. See {Post} a postman.]
     One who rides and guides the first pair of horses of a coach
     or post chaise; also, one who rides one of the horses when
     one pair only is used. [Written also {postillion}.]
     [1913 Webster]



From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]:

  postilion
       n : someone who rides the near horse of a pair in order to guide
           the horses pulling a carriage (especially a carriage
           without a coachman) [syn: {postillion}]
